Banyule Mayor used taxpayer funds to reward community group for factional work, IBAC hears

A corruption inquiry has heard the Mayor of a Melbourne council successfully lobbied for state government grants to be given to a community group to reward factional work, with the leader then pocketing significant portions of the taxpayer funds.
